TRANSPORTATION

Crawford County Council on Aging provides Specialized Transportation to seniors (60 years & older) and individuals with disabilities.  Rides for the general public can be provided if seating is available. 

Transportation services operate Monday through Friday from 6:00am to 5:00pm. Door to door services are provided to various medical appointments, grocery stores, beauty shops, etc. Vans are equipped with wheelchair lifts and the drivers are trained in all areas of transportation.

Transportation to medical appointments in Marion, Mansfield, and Columbus is available for passengers 60 years and older. Transportation to out-of-county medical appointments are dependent on availability of vehicles and drivers. Out-of-county requests require at least one- week advance notice. 

Donation request for out-of-county trips for seniors 60 and older:

Marion (round trip) $25.00–Tuesdays

Mansfield (round trip) $25.00–Wednesdays

Columbus (round trip) $40.00–Thursdays 

{When requesting a trip you will be asked to give required personal information, along with trip information including the exact address of your destination.

A fare is collected each time a passenger boards the van. Passengers must have the exact fare. Drivers cannot make change.

  • Donation request for seniors 60 and older:

  • $4.00 (one-way) to travel from city to city, within the county

  • $3.00 (one-way) within the same city

  • $2.00 (one-way) for disabled passengers within the county- proof of disability required.

  • Passengers 60 years and older will not be refused transportation services due to the inability to  donate. All donations are voluntary and confidential. All donations are used to expand good and services for seniors residing in Crawford county.

Reasonable Accommodation

Requests for accommodation may be made either orally or in writing. The reasonable accommodation process begins as soon as the request for accommodation is made. The request can be submitted in any written format. Alternative means of filing a request, such as personal interviews, phone calls, or taped requests, will be made available for persons with disabilities if unable to communicate their request in writing or upon request.
